**Mgmt Meeting Minutes — Retiring the Brightline Range**

Quick recap for sales leads at Fenholt Supplies: we agreed to retire the Brightline fixture range by year-end. Remaining stock moves to clearance pricing next month, and accounts on standing orders get migrated to the Lumetta range. Trade-in incentives were approved in principle. The confidential note on next steps sits just below.

board note of bajof-bajeg: The pricing group signed off on a budget of $13.4 million for Project Sildor. The renewal with Lamixek Holdings closes at $48.9 million a year, 49 percent above the last contract.

## Swellgate Autoscaler 3.2

Heads up, support folks — the queue-depth autoscaler now scales on a rolling five-minute average instead of instantaneous depth, so you'll see fewer of those bouncy scale-up/scale-down cycles customers kept reporting. We also added a floor setting per queue, and the dashboard now shows why a scaling decision was made. If a tenant complains about slow scale-up, check the new decision log first. For anything weirder than that, ping the engineer named below.

account owner for bawip-tahag: Raleth Quenok

Finance Review Summary — Pellbright Lamp Range

Prepared for the incoming director. The Pellbright range has held steady pricing for three years while component costs rose roughly nine percent. Margins on the compact models remain healthy; the floor-standing units are near break-even. Finance proposes a staged increase beginning next quarter, paired with a trimmed discount ladder for trade customers in the Ostbury region. The strategic context your predecessor flagged is summarised immediately below.

board note of kageg-bahof: The renewal with Holwynax Holdings closes at $2 million a year, 5 percent below the last contract. Project Ulaath slips by two quarters because of the supplier delay.

Hey, welcome aboard! The FareForge rules engine computes shipping fees for Quillport orders. Rules live in the tariff store and reload every five minutes, so edits aren't instant. If a rule misfires, disable it rather than deleting — history matters here. To run the engine locally, use these settings.

service settings:
PRAIX_LOG_LEVEL=error
PRAIX_METRICS_HOST=metrics.praix.qorvelcorp.corp
PRAIX_POOL_SIZE=16